Transaction 66e453bd1af4346809605e71b2e9d78682782fc9d126b2121809dd477874a075

1 Input
2 Outputs
  • 66e453bd1af4346809605e71b2e9d78682782fc9d126b2121809dd477874a075:0
  • value  300000000
    address  2NAaYFfEKoeCKRk778f5eGRVix9TBcAuWyX
  • 66e453bd1af4346809605e71b2e9d78682782fc9d126b2121809dd477874a075:1
  • value  268520
    address  2N612K9YUjx6Sf7gUGDi1t2qFJ73kkdFgby